Q1: What is the significance of IMO MEPC.107(49) compliance?
A: IMO MEPC.107(49) is the International Maritime Organization resolution that sets the performance standards and test specifications for oily-water separating equipment and oil content meters. This certification is mandatory for all vessels subject to MARPOL Annex I. Type approval to MEPC.107(49) guarantees that the bilge water separator has been independently tested and proven to consistently achieve the required ≤15ppm effluent quality under specified conditions, ensuring compliance with international regulations and preventing port state control detentions.

Q2: Why are three separate components (separator, alarm, stopping device) required?
A: IMO regulations require a complete system with redundant safety features:

  1. 15ppm Separator: Performs the actual oil-water separation.

  2. 15ppm Alarm: Continuously monitors effluent quality. If the separator malfunctions and oil content approaches or exceeds 15ppm, the alarm activates.

  3. Automatic Stopping Device: When the alarm triggers, this device automatically diverts non-compliant flow back to the bilge tank and/or stops overboard discharge, ensuring that no polluted water ever enters the marine environment.
    This three-part system provides multiple layers of protection against accidental pollution.

Q4: What is the difference between dry weight and wet weight?
A:

  • Dry Weight (1500 kg): The weight of the separator system itself, empty of fluids. Used for shipping, lifting, and installation planning.

  • Wet Weight (2800 kg): The operational weight when the system is filled with water and fluids. Used for structural support calculations for the deck or foundation where the unit will be mounted.
    The 1300 kg difference represents the water and fluids contained within the system during normal operation—this must be considered when designing the supporting structure.

Q5: What does “suction head not more than 6m-H₂O” mean for installation?
A: Suction head refers to the vertical distance between the water level in the bilge tank and the pump inlet. A maximum suction head of 6 meters water column means:

  • The pump can lift water from a bilge tank located up to 6 meters below the separator.

  • Installation must ensure the vertical lift does not exceed this value.

  • Exceeding this limit may cause cavitation, reduced flow, or pump failure.
    This parameter is critical for proper system layout in vessels with deep bilge tanks.

Q6: What routine maintenance does the YSZ-0.25 require?
A: Regular maintenance ensures optimal performance:

  • Daily: Visual inspection for leaks, check pressure gauges.

  • Weekly: Verify alarm operation, inspect pump for unusual noise.

  • Monthly: Clean strainers, check oil levels in pump, inspect electrical connections.

  • Quarterly: Test safety devices, verify calibration of 15ppm alarm (per manufacturer’s instructions).

  • Annually: Professional service of pump, replace seals if needed, internal inspection of separator, pressure vessel inspection if required.

  • As Needed: Replace filter elements, clean separation plates, service DECKMA monitor per manual.
